python-sqlite is providing "sqlite" module (for SQLite2) and python-
pysqlite2 - "pysqlite2" (for SQLite3). The only conflicting data is Egg
info.

I suggest to remove Egg info from python-sqlite package (so that: 
`python -c 'import pkg_resources; pkg_resources.require("pysqlite")'` will 
return pysqlite2 data.

btw: Griffith uses python-sqlite to convert databases from SQLite2 to
SQLite3 while upgrading from 0.6.2
